Modularni sustav provjere rješenja zadataka iz programskog jezika C

Sažetak na hrvatskom: Cilj rada je izrada modularnog sustava koji nudi mogućnosti kreiranja zadataka i ispita, te provjere rješenja za programski jezik C. Korisnici sustavu pristupaju putem aplikacije Edgar u koju su ugrađene opcije kreiranja pitanja i ispita za programski jezik C te validacija i...

Full description

Permalink: http://skupni.nsk.hr/Record/fer.KOHA-OAI-FER:49437/Details
Glavni autor: Medved, Kristina (-)
Ostali autori: Milašinović, Boris (Thesis advisor)
Vrsta građe: Drugo
Impresum: Zagreb, K. Medved, 2017.
Predmet:
LEADER 02320na a2200229 4500
003 HR-ZaFER
008 160221s2017 ci ||||| m||| 00| 0 hr d
035 |a (HR-ZaFER)ferid5496 
040 |a HR-ZaFER  |b hrv  |c HR-ZaFER  |e ppiak 
100 1 |a Medved, Kristina 
245 1 0 |a Modularni sustav provjere rješenja zadataka iz programskog jezika C :  |b završni rad /  |c Kristina Medved ; [mentor Boris Milašinović]. 
246 1 |a A Modular System for Testing Students Tasks Written in C Programming Language  |i Naslov na engleskom:  
260 |a Zagreb,  |b K. Medved,  |c 2017. 
300 |a 36 str. ;  |c 30 cm +  |e CD-ROM 
502 |b preddiplomski studij  |c Fakultet elektrotehnike i računarstva u Zagrebu  |g smjer: Programsko inženjerstvo i informacijski sustavi, šifra smjera: 39, datum predaje: 2017-06-09, datum završetka: 2017-07-10 
520 3 |a Sažetak na hrvatskom: Cilj rada je izrada modularnog sustava koji nudi mogućnosti kreiranja zadataka i ispita, te provjere rješenja za programski jezik C. Korisnici sustavu pristupaju putem aplikacije Edgar u koju su ugrađene opcije kreiranja pitanja i ispita za programski jezik C te validacija i ocjenjivanje rezultata. Posao prevođenja i izvršavanja programa obavlja zasebni sustav. Sustav za prevođenje i izvršavanje programa sastoji se od glavnog web poslužitelja koji prima zahtjeve putem HTTP protokola i delegira ih na pomoćne web poslužitelje koristeći balansiranje opterećenja. 
520 3 |a Sažetak na engleskom: The aim of this paper is to create a modular system that offers the possibility of creating tasks and exams, and checking solutions for the programming language C. Users access the system through the Edgar application, which incorporates question and exam options, for C language, and validation and evaluation of results. Compilation and execution of the program is a job of a separate system. System for compiling and executing the program consists of the main web server that receives requests through HTTP protocol and delegates them to auxiliary web servers using load balancing. 
653 1 |a web poslužitelj  |a docker  |a prevođenje i izvršavanje programa  |a evaluacija rezultata 
653 1 |a web server  |a docker  |a compilation and execution of a program  |a results evaluation 
700 1 |a Milašinović, Boris  |4 ths 
942 |c Z 
999 |c 49437  |d 49437